Access《大数据库基本知识》综合练习精彩试题.docx
《Access《大数据库基本知识》综合练习精彩试题.docx》由会员分享,可在线阅读,更多相关《Access《大数据库基本知识》综合练习精彩试题.docx(16页珍藏版)》请在冰豆网上搜索。
Access《大数据库基本知识》综合练习精彩试题
Access2010《数据库基本知识》综合练习试题
(共有37题;满分:
39分;总时;80分钟)
第1题:
(单选题,1分)
面关于关系叙述中,错误的是
A.一个关系是一二维表
C.有的二维表不是关系
B.二维表一定是关系
D.同一列只能出自同一个域
[A]选A[B]选B[C]
选C[D]
选D
答案:
B
第2题:
(单选题,1分)
在E-R图中,用来表示实体之间联系的图形是
D.菱形
A.椭圆形B.矩形C.三角形[A]选A[B]选B[C]选C[D]选D
答案:
D
第3题:
(单选题,1分)
下列实体的联系中,属于多对多的联系是。
A.工厂与厂长
B.工厂与车间
C.车间与车间主任
D.读者与图书馆图书
[A]选A[B]选B[C]选C[D]选D
答案:
D
第4题:
(单选题,1分)
假定有关系模式:
部门(部门号,部门名称),职工(职工号,,性别,职称,
部门号),工资(职工号,基本工资,奖金),级别(职称,对应行政级别),要查找在
“财务部”工作的职工的及奖金,将涉及的关系是。
A.职工,工资B.职工,部门
C.部门,级别,工资D.职工,工资,部门
[A]选A[B]选B[C]选C[D]选D
答案:
D
第5题:
(单选题,1分)
在Access表中,可以定义3种主关键字,它们是
A.单字段、双字段和多字段
B.单字段、双字段和自动编号
C.
D.
单字段、
双字段、
多字段和自动编号多字段和自动编号
[A]选A
[B]
选B[C]选C
[D]
选D
答案:
C
第6题:
(单选题,1分)在打开某个Access2010数据库后,双击“导航窗格”上的表对象列表中的某个表名,便可打开
该表的。
A.关系视图B.查询视图C.设计视图D.数据表视图
[A]选A[B]选B[C]选C[D]选D答案:
D
第7题:
(单选题,1分)
对于Access2010数据库,在下列数据类型中,不可以设置“字段大小”属性的是。
A.文本B.数字C.备注D.自动编号(分长整、同步复制ID)
[A]选A[B]选B[C]选C[D]选D
答案:
C
第8题:
(单选题,1分)在表设计视图中,若要将某个表中的若干个字段定义为主键,需要先按住键,
逐个单击所需字段后,再单击“主键”按钮。
A.ShiftB.CtrlC.AltD.Tab
[A]选A[B]选B[C]选C[D]选D
答案:
B
第9题:
(单选题,1分)
在Access数据库中,要往数据表中追加新记录,需要使用
D.操作查询
"是"
A.交叉表查询B.选择查询C.参数查询
[A]选A[B]选B[C]选C[D]选D答案:
D
第10题:
(单选题,1分)
在下列有关“是/否”类型字段的查询条件设置中,设置正确的是
A."False"B."True"C.TrueD
[A]选A[B]选B[C]选C[D]选D答案:
C
第11题:
(单选题,1分)数据表中有一个“”字段,查找最后一个字为“菲”的条件是
A.Right(,1)="菲"
B.Right([]:
1)="菲"
C.Right([],1)=[菲]
D.Right([],1)="菲"
[A]选A[B]选B[C]选C[D]选D
第12题:
(单选题,1分)有一“职工”表,该表中有职工编号、、性别、职位和工资五个字段的信息,
现要求显示所有职位不是工程师的女职工的信息。
能完成该功能的SQL语句是
A.SELECT*FROM职工WHERE职位<>"工程师"性别="女"
B.SELECT*FROM职工WHERE职位<>"工程师"and性别=女
C.
性别="女
SELECT*FROM职工WHERE职位<>"工程师"or
D.
and性别="女
SELECT*FROM职工WHERE职位<>"工程师"
[A]选A[B]选B[C]选C[D]选D
答案:
D
第13题:
(单选题,1分)
有一“职工”表,该表中有职工编号、、性别、职位和工资五个字段的信息,
现需要按性别统计工资低于800元的人数,则使用的SQL语句是。
A.SELECT性别,COUNT(*)AS人数FROM职工WHERE工资<800ORDERBY性别;
B.SELECT性别,COUNT(*)AS人数FROM职工WHERE工资<800GROUPBY性别;
C.SELECT性别,SUM(*)AS人数FROM职工WHERE工资<800GROUPBY性别;
D.SELECT性别,AVG(*)AS人数FROM职工
WHERE工资<800GROUPBY性别;
[A]选A[B]选B[C]选C[D]选D
答案:
B
第14题:
(单选题,1分)某工厂数据库中使用表“产品”记录生产信息,该表包括小组编号、日期、产量等
字段,每个记录保存了一个小组一天的产量等信息。
现需要统计每个小组在2005年
全年的总产量,则使用的SQL命令是。
A.SELECT小组编号,SUM(产量)AS总产量FROM产品
WHERE日期>=#2005-1-1#OR日期<#2006-1-1#GROUPBY小组编号
B.SELECT小组编号,SUM(产量)AS总产量FROM产品
WHERE日期>#2005-1-1#AND日期<#2006-1-1#GROUPBY小组编号
C.SELECT小组编号,SUM(产量)AS总产量FROM产品
WHERE日期>=#2005-1-1#AND日期<#2006-1-1#GROUPBY小组编号
D.SELECT小组编号,SUM(产量)AS总产量FROM产品
WHERE日期>#2005-1-1#AND日期<#2005-12-31#GROUPBY小组编号
[A]选A[B]选B[C]选C[D]选D答案:
C
第15题:
(单选题,1分)在窗体设计过程中,经常要使用的三种属性是窗体属性、和节属性。
A.关系属性B.查询属性C.字段属性D.控件属性
[A]选A[B]选B[C]选C[D]选D答案:
D
第16题:
(单选题,1分)
在Access数据库中,数据透视表窗体的数据源是。
A.Word文档B.表或查询C.报表D.Web文档
[A]选A[B]选B[C]选C[D]选D答案:
B
第17题:
(单选题,1分)
学号由8位数字组成的字符串,为学号设置输入掩码,正确的是
A.########
B.99999999
C.LLLLLLLL
D.00000000
(因只能
0—9数字并且必须输入)
[A]选A[B]选B
[C]选C
[D]
选D
第18题:
(单选题,1分)
查询排序时如果选取了多个字段,则输出结果是。
A.先对最左侧字段排序,然后对其右侧的下一个字段排序,以此类推
B.先对最右侧字段排序,然后对其左侧的下一个字段排序,以此类推
C.按主键从大到小进行排序
D.无法进行排序
[A]选A[B]选B[C]选C[D]选D
答案:
A
第19题:
(单选题,1分)
在Access数据库中,为了保持表之间的关系,要求在子表(从表)中添加记录时,
如果主表中没有与之相关的记录,则不能在子表
(从表)中添加该记录。
为此需要
定义的关系是。
A.输入掩码
C.默认值
B.有效性规则
D.参照完整性
[A]选A[B]选B[C]选C[D]
选D
答案:
D
第20题:
(单选题,1分)
如果要将文本型数据"12"、"6"、"5"按升序排列,其排列的结果是。
A."12"
、"6"、"5"
B.
"12"
、"5"、
C."5"、
"6"、"12"
D.
"5"
、"12"、
[A]选A
[B]选B
[C]
选C
答案:
B
"6"(数有12>5,但字符串“12”<”5”)"6"
[D]选D
第21题:
(单选题,1分)
采用Select语句中的计算函数“Avg”,可以求所在字段所有的值的
A.总和B.平均值C.最小值D.第
[A]选A[B]选B[C]选C[D]选D
答案:
B
第22题:
(单选题,1分)
在窗体中,对于“是/否”类型字段,默认的控件类型是。
A.复选框B.文本框C.列表框D.
[A]选A[B]选B[C]选C[D]选D
答案:
A(从表结构设计的属性中的“查阅可看到)
第23题:
(多选题,1分)
个值
按钮
面关于数据库基本概念的叙述中,正确的是
A.DBS包含了DBMS
B.DBS包含了DB
C.DBMS包含了DBS
D.DBS包含了DBMS和DB两者
[A]选A[B]
选B[C]选C[D]选D
答案:
ABD
第24题:
(多选题,1分)
在Access数据库中,下列关于表的说法,错误的是
A.表中每一列元素必须是相同类型的数据
B.在表中不可以含有图形数据
C.表是Access数据库对象之一
D.一个Access数据库只能包含一个表
[A]选A[B]选B[C]选C[D]选D
答案:
BD
第25题:
(多选题,1分)
下列关于查询的说法中,正确的是。
A.可以利用查询来更新数据表中的记录
B.在查询设计视图中可以进行查询字段是否显示的设定
C.不可以利用查询来删除表中的记录
D.在查询设计视图中可以进行查询条件的设定
[A]选A[B]选B[C]选C[D]选D
答案:
ABD
第26题:
(多选题,1分)
要查找“”
字段头两个字为“
区阳”,采用的条件是
A.Right([],2)="
区阳"
B.Left([],2)="区阳"
C.Like
"区阳?
"
D.Like"区阳*"
[A]选A
[B]
选B
[C]选C[D]选D
答案:
BD
第27题:
(多选题,1分)
在Access中,下列关于窗体的说法,不正确的是
A.在窗体设计视图中,可以对窗体进行结构的修改
B.在窗体设计视图中,可以进行数据记录的浏览
C.在窗体设计视图中,可以进行数据记录的添加
D.在窗体视图中,可以对窗体进行结构的修改
[A]选A[B]选B[C]选C[D]选D
答案:
BCD
第28题:
(多选题,1分)
在以下叙述中,正确的是。
A.Access不具备程序设计能力
B.在数据表视图中,不能设置主键
C.在数据表视图中,不能修改字段的名称
D.在数据表视图中,可以删除一个字段
E.SQL是一种结构化查询语言
[A]选A[B]选B[C]选C[D]选D
[E]选E
答案:
BDE
第29题:
(判断题,1分)
在数据库系统的三个抽象层次结构中,表示用户层数据库的模式称为模式。
答案:
F
第30题:
(判断题,1分)
在删除查询中,删除过的记录可以用“撤销”命令恢复。
答案:
F
第31题:
(判断题,1分)
如果想在已建立的“tSalary”表的数据表视图中直接显示出姓“”的记录,应使用Access提供的记录筛选功能。
答案:
T
第32题:
(判断题,1分)
在Access2010数据库中,打开某个数据表后,可以修改该表与其他表之间的已经建立的关系。
答案:
F
第33题:
(判断题,1分)
在Acccss2010数据库中,查询的数据源只能是表。
答案:
F
第34题:
(判断题,1分)
在Access2010数据库中,在列表框中不可以输入新值,在组合框中可以输入新值。
答案:
T(可设列表框、组合框试看!
)
第35题:
(判断题,1分)如果字段容为声音文件,则该字段的数据类型应定义为备注。
答案:
F
第36题:
(操作题,2分)
注意问题:
1数据库的扩展名为:
mdb,不是ACCDB,按原MDB保存;
2不要删除提供考试的已有数据库,包括已有数据表,
也不要删除已有的记录;
3创建的数据表和查询、窗体等按题目给的对象名保存。
(建议先操作好部分就保存,然后做好一点就按保存按钮)。
基本操作题
(1)如果考生还没有登录G盘,请先登录G盘。
在G盘的“综合练习”
(2)文件夹下已存有相应的数据库文件和相关的源数据文件。
考生不得更
改这些文件的文件名,不得删除这些文件。
(3)启动Access2010,打开“综合练习”文件夹下的已有的
“人事管理.mdb”数据库,在“人事管理.mdb”数据库中,
创建下列“人事”及“工资”两个表的结构。
①创建如下“人事”表结构,主键是“职工编号”
字段名
职工编号
性别
年龄
婚否
工作日期
简历
字段类型
文本
文本
文本
数字
是/否
日期/时间
备注
字段大小
3
8
1
整型
短日期
说明
True表示已婚,False表示未婚
建表的结构时,要将婚否字段的属性的“格式”设为选:
真/假—TRUE
②为“人事”表的“职工编号”字段设置“输入掩码”为“000”
(即3个零),为“性别”字段设置默认值“男"。
③创建如下“工资”表结构,主键是“职工编号”。
字段名
职工编号
基本工资
补贴
水电费
房租
字段类型
文本
数字
数字
数字
数字
工资.xls”导入到对应的表中
导入数据出错(如下标越界)的解决方法:
检查表结构字段的参数(字段名、类型等)有无输错,如没错:
1)关闭数据库,重新打开,再导入;
(4)关闭“人事管理”数据库。
第37题:
(操作题,2分)
应用操作题
(1)如果考生还没有登录G盘,请先登录G盘。
在G盘的“综合练习”文件夹下已存有相应的数据库文件和相关的源数据文件。
考生不得更改这些文件的文件名,不得删除这些文件。
(2)启动Access2010,打开“综合练习”文件夹下的已有的
“职工管理.mdb”数据库。
在“职工管理.mdb”数据库中存在已经设计好的两个表对象“职工”和“薪金”。
注意,这两个表中都已录入了数据,不得删除这两个表中已有数据!
1“职工”表结构如下(主键是“职工编号”):
字段名
职工编号
性别
年龄
婚否
工作日期
简历
字段类型
文本
文本
文本
数字
是/否
日期/时间
备注
字段大小
3
8
1
整型
TRUE-已婚,FALSE-未婚
短日期
说明
True表示已婚,False表示未婚
②“薪金”表结构如下(主键是“职工编号”):
字段名
职工编号
基本工资
补贴
水电费
房租
字段类型
文本
数字
数字
数字
数字
字段大小
3
长整型
长整型
整型
整型
(3)在“职工管理.mdb”数据库中,创建一个查询对象,查询在2000年前
参加工作的已婚的女职工的有关信息。
显示的字段有:
职工编号、、性别、工作日期和基本工资。
查询结果按“基本工资”升序排列。
查询名称为“查询在2000年前参加工作的已婚的女职工信息”。
日期(如出生日期、工作日期)判别式的写法:
1)如2000年前参加工作:
<=#1999-12-31#或year([工作日期])<2000
2)如2000年后参加工作:
>=#2001-1-1#或year([工作日期])>2000
3婚)否为如“20是00/否至”20字01段年,参假加定工:
作:
已婚>为=#2T0R0U0E-1、-1#未a婚nd为<=F#A2L0S01E-,12则-3对1#“已婚”的条件,在对应字段的条件输入:
true/yes/on/-1之一都可!
(4)在“职工管理.mdb”数据库中,创建一个查询对象,查询基本工资
在[3000,4000]围的男职工有关信息及基本工资2500以下和基本工资3000(含3000)以上的女职工有关信息。
条件应为:
1)基本工资:
>=3000and<=4000and性别=“男”;
或2)基本工资:
>=3000or<2500AND性别=”女”;
显示的字段有:
职工编号、、性别、基本工资和补贴。
查询结果按性别升序、“基本工资”降序排列。
查询名称为“查询职工的部分工资信息”。
(5)在“职工管理.mdb”数据库中,创建一个查询对象,查询男、女职工的基本工资总额。
显示的字段有:
性别和基本工资总额。
查询名称为“查询男、女职工的基本工资总额”。
查询统计注意问题:
1)只能对数字型字段才能求“和”、“平均”统计。
2)没指定分组字段就全部(即整个表)作统计,如对“职工”表求工资总额、平
均补贴等。
3)只一个字段分组,用“汇总--∑”就可,不要交叉表,如对“学生”表统计男
(6)在“职工管理.mdb”数据库中,创建一个查询对象,查询工作日期为1998年1月1日和1999年1月1日的职工信息。
条件:
工作日期:
#1998-1-1#or#1999-1-1#显示的字段有:
显示的字段有:
职工编号、、性别、工作日期和基本工资。
查询名称为“查询指定工作日期的职工的有关信息”。
(7)模仿书中例5-9(书第140页)基本做法,创建一个窗体(不含子窗体),用于浏览“职工”表中的数据,窗体界面类似于(书第141页)图5-43,但不含子窗体。
①在窗体的页眉中创建一个标签控件和一个文本框控件:
标签控件显示标题“浏览职工基本情况”
文本框中输入函数“=Date()”,以“短日期”格式显示当前日期。
2在窗体主体部分中创建7个绑定控件(对应于“职工”表中的7个
字段)
3在窗体的页脚中创建“第一个记录”、“上一个记录”、“下一个记录”和最后一个记录”等四个记录导航按钮和一个“退出”按钮。
窗体名称为“浏览职工基本情况”。
(8)关闭“职工管理”数据库。